Viv Greene Attorney & Notary The practice was established by British-born attorney Viv Greene, who, after working in the UK, moved to South Africa and worked for several reputable legal firms in Pietermaritzburg before starting her own legal firm in April 2011.She has worked in various areas of civil litigation and now mainly focuses on High Court litigation, labour, land issues and evictions in terms of both PIE and ESTA, and also advises clients on BEE. She has right of appearance in the High Court.Viv believes that excellent service is the minimum standard clients should expect from Viv Greene Attorneys. Her staff are recruited on the basis they have the same mantra hard wired into their system. Another aspect she has found leads to lots of referrals, is that every staff member is focused on efficiency and helping each clients legal matter arrive at a winning or best possible conclusion as quick as possible, thus keeping the clients costs down.
